Normal people do not celebrate racism in 12-year-old

185

Today a 12-year-old was charged for shouting a racist abuse at December’s Celtic v Newco game in December.  No normal human being celebrates the discovery of a 12-year-old shouting racist abuse.  This is not how a functional person, football club or society works.  The statement issued by Newco tonight sullies us all.  We share the same soil with people who think like this; how pitiful.

It is regretful that a 12-year-old Celtic supporter has (allegedly) behaved in this manner, but it was a season ticket holder sitting nearby who reported him – for this, we can be pleased.  That the act is so rare we report it, is a great thing.  We should continue to act in the right manner if something similar happens again.  Rise above those living in the gutter and continue to set standards as Celtic supporters.
